    Hey there Daniel,
    It sounds like you are being prompted over and over for your Login Keychain, and entering it does not seem to make the prompts stop. I would start by running First Aid on the Keychain with this article:
    Mac OS X 10.6: Solving problems with keychains
    http://support.apple.com/kb/ph7296
    To check keychains for problems using Keychain First Aid:
    Open Keychain Access, located in the Utilites folder in the Applications folder.
    Choose Keychain Access > Keychain First Aid.
    Enter your user name and password.
    Select Verify and click Start. Any problems found will be displayed.
    If there are problems, select Repair, and then click Start.
    If that does not resolve the issue, I would next reset your Keychain:
    In Keychain Access, choose Preferences from the Keychain Access menu.
    If available, click the Reset My Default Keychain button. This will remove the login keychain and create a new one with the password provided.
    If Reset My Default Keychain is not available, choose Keychain List from the Edit menu.
    Delete the "login" keychain.
    The next time you log in to the account, you can save your current password in a keychain.

    Can anybody give me some instructions on how to manually install the PDF printer?
    I am running windows 7

    Launch the Devices and printers setup utility through the Control Panel.
    2Select the \"Add a Printer\" option.
    3Click the \"Next\" button and select the \"Local Printer Attached to This Computer\" option.
    4Deselect (uncheck the box) the  \"Automatically Detect and Install My Plug and Play Printer\" option and  click the \"Next\" button.
    5Select \"My Documents\\*.pdf (Adobe PDF)\" in the port selection drop-down menu and click the \"Next\" button.
    6Select the \"Have Disk\" option and click the \"Browse\" button to open a dialog box.
    7Select the \"AdobePDF.inf\" file  located in the AdobePDF folder in your Program Files directory under  \"Adobe,\" \"Acrobat 9.0,\" \"Acrobat,\" \"Xtras.\"
    8Select the first item (top item) on the list of Adobe PDF Converter options and click the \"Next\" button.
    9Type \"Adobe PDF\" in the field for a printer name and click \"Next.\"

  • Why does my phones iMessage keep saying "waiting for activation"

    Why does my iPhone's iMessage keep saying "waiting for activation" when I turn on my iMessage

    It's waiting for you to reply to a confirmation email that was sent when you added that email address to Settings > Messages > Send & Receive.
    The email is sent immediately. If you have reason to believe it was not sent, tap the blue circled i then either resend the validation email, or remove it.
